Article: PACIFIC CLASSIC COULD BE BIG BOOST FOR CHALLENGE.(Sports)

Byline: Kevin Modesti Staff Writer

Will the Pacific Classic be remembered for the horse who wins or the horses who didn't run?

That's up to General Challenge and jockey David Flores.

If any excitement remains in Del Mar's $1 million race, weakened by injuries to a succession of favorites, it resides in the muscular body of General Challenge, the flashy but flighty gelding who faces older horses for the first time today.

A victory would - if it's done in style - revive the ``rising-star'' talk that followed his Santa Anita Derby victory in April.
